Wye is a locality in Missoula County, Montana, United States. It has a population of approximately 1,055. The population density is 161.5 people per km². Wye is located at 46.9530°N, 114.1215°W. It observes the Mountain Time (America/Denver) timezone. ZIP code: 59808.

It lies 8.2 miles north-west of Missoula, MT (from Missoula, MT: bearing 313°T), and is situated 7.1 miles north-north-west of Orchard Homes.
